/>
Vreau demo

"*" indicates required fields

This field is for validation purposes and should be left unchanged.
* campuri obligatorii
Cere oferta

"*" indicates required fields

This field is for validation purposes and should be left unchanged.
* campuri obligatorii
Prin completarea formularului, iti dai acordul sa fii contactat de un consultant NextUp.

"*" indicates required fields

* campuri obligatorii
Prin completarea formularului, iti dai acordul sa fii contactat de un consultant NextUp.

"*" indicates required fields

This field is for validation purposes and should be left unchanged.

"*" indicates required fields

This field is for validation purposes and should be left unchanged.
Max. file size: 1 GB.
Max. file size: 1 GB.

"*" indicates required fields

This field is for validation purposes and should be left unchanged.
Max. file size: 1 GB.
Max. file size: 1 GB.
Cere oferta

"*" indicates required fields

This field is for validation purposes and should be left unchanged.
* campuri obligatorii
Prin completarea formularului, iti dai acordul sa fii contactat de un consultant NextUp.

JavaScript Developer (Full Stack) 

Aplicație: Software de salarizare | Accent pe Backend 

La NextUp, valorile noastre sunt simple, dar esențiale: colaborare, dezvoltare continuă și orientare către rezultate. De peste 30 de ani, sprijinim mediul de afaceri românesc prin soluții software eficiente, iar echipa noastră este inima acestui succes. 

Ce ne diferențiază? Mediul de lucru. Apreciem responsabilitatea, creativitatea și dorința de a învăța, oferindu-ți libertatea de a evolua într-un cadru stabil. Vei lucra pe produse mature, folosite de zeci de mii de utilizatori, fără presiunea schimbărilor constante de proiect. Biroul este central și luminos, dar lucrăm și remote, printr-un model hibrid flexibil. Ne pasă de echilibru – programul este clar, fără ore suplimentare, iar reușitele sunt recunoscute public și echilibrate prin evenimente lunare și teambuilding-uri anuale. 

Suntem parte dintr-o companie de produs, în care fiecare linie de cod contează. Iar odată cu fuziunea cu grupul Symfonia, companie internațională cu portofoliu solid în zona de soluții contabile și ERP, se deschid oportunități reale de a lucra în proiecte mai ample, de a învăța din alte arhitecturi tehnice și de a colabora cu echipe cu expertiză complementară. Rămâi ancorat în realitatea locală, dar ai acces la o viziune mai largă și contexte internaționale de învățare și creștere. 

Căutăm un JavaScript Developer pasionat de clean code, care poate înțelege și contribui activ într-un ecosistem complex. Nu căutăm doar un executant de task-uri, ci un coleg care își lasă amprenta asupra codului și a echipei. 
Dacă ai experiență solidă cu Node.js și React, dacă știi cum să propui îmbunătățiri, să gândești logic un backend și să evaluezi impactul deciziilor tehnice, vrem să lucrăm cu tine. 

Ne potrivim dacă ai: 

  • Cunoștințe solide de JavaScript, HTML, CSS/SASS 
    (ex: promises, async/await, IIFE, constructors, classes, this, ES6+, closures, lexical scope, media queries, box model, positioning) 
  • Peste 3 ani experiență cu Node.js, preferabil folosind Express (ex: event loop, modules creation and management) 
  • Cel puțin 2 ani experiență cu React (ex: react router, class components, functional components, lifecycle hooks, controlled vs uncontrolled forms, code splitting, higher order components) 
  • Înțelegere avansată a mecanismului de tratare a requesturilor asincrone și a update-urilor parțiale ale paginilor 
  • Experiență în utilizarea și configurarea bundler-elor (ex: Webpack) 
  • Cunoștințe în utilizarea sistemelor de versionare (ex: Git, managementul branch-urilor, merge-uri, rezolvarea conflictelor) 
  • Experiență cu aplicații bazate pe arhitectură de tip microservicii 
  • Experiență în lucrul cu baze de date non-relaționale (ex: Couchbase, MongoDB) 

Ce vei face: 

  • Participi la arhitectura și planificarea proiectelor – unele cu durată scurtă (6 luni), altele cu versionări lunare și durată de peste un an 
  • Asiguri mentenanța în producție pentru servere și baze de date (actualizări, backup-uri, uptime) 
  • Contribui la mentenanța codului sursă 
  • Estimezi efortul pentru task-uri și faci code review 
  • Realizezi analize tehnice pentru task-uri mai complexe 

Ce iti oferim: 

Flexibilitate reală
• Full remote, dacă nu ești din București 
• Hybrid (1 zi/săptămână la birou), dacă ești din București 

Timp și spațiu pentru tine
• Zile suplimentare de concediu de odihnă 
• Program clar, fără overtime 

Cultură de echipă sănătoasă
• Evenimente recurente, teambuilding-uri anuale 
• Colaborare reală, structură pe orizontală, fără birocrație 

Mediu de creștere tehnică
• Acces la cursuri, traininguri și învățare continuă 
• Tehnologii actuale, procese clare, ownership 
• Lucru agil, în echipe autonome 

💡 Fuziunea cu grupul Symfonia îți deschide accesul la proiecte internaționale, arhitecturi solide și colegi din afară cu care poți învăța și colabora. 
Și totuși, echipa ta rămâne aici, cu control local și decizii rapide. 

📩 Vrei să afli mai multe? Scrie-mi pe simona.vina@nextup.ro sau dă-mi un semn direct aici. 

Aplica acum